Vince Vaughn Gets His "Claus" Into a New Holiday Comedy

Posted by Scott Weinberg on Monday, Feb. 27, 2006, 01:16 AM
Found here

Scott Weinberg writes: "According to Variety, funny guy Vince Vaughn will star in a new holiday comedy entitled "Fred Claus," a project that'll reunite him with his "Clay Pigeons" and "Wedding Crashers" director David Dobkin.

"The "Wedding Crashers" team of Vince Vaughn and director David Dobkin are at the altar for "Fred Claus," a Warner Bros. holiday comedy about Santa's loser brother.

While negotiations are just beginning, deal should see Vaughn cement his status as a comedy-carrying star by reaching the $20 million salary mark for the first time. Dan Fogelman wrote the script and Dobkin is producing with Jessie Nelson.

Comedy revolves around Santa's black-sheep brother, who heads back to the North Pole and gets a chance to redeem himself.""
